US Magazine Cover Attacks Sarah Palin - Did they go too Far?

US Weekly Magazine has drifted away from its typical Britney Spears and Angelina Jolie Hollywood headlines and is taking a political stance in this week’s edition – and the controversial cover is taking the tabloid world by storm.

US Magazine publisher Jann Wenner has no problem planting the face of McCain’s pick, Sarah Palin on the front cover of this week’s issue, with controversial headlines like “Babies, Lies and Scandals.”

The new issue, hitting newsstands Wednesday, is slamming the Alaskan Governor for everything from her racy past to the pregnancy of her 17-year-old daughter.

US Weekly Magazine  Sarah Palin

Sarah has been making headlines since McCain announced her as his pick for VP last week but it seems like the scandalous 44-year-old mother of five has more skeletons in her closet than Eliot Spitzer.

College photos of Palin wearing a t-shirt with the words “I may be broke but I’m not flat busted” (seen above) seem to indicate she’s better fit for a strip club than a presidential campaign.

But, racy past and family matters aside, has US Weekly gone too far with this week’s cover?
